White Rose Wellness
Hamsa Mandala Cushion - 60x60cm - green
Hamsa Mandala Cushion - 60x60cm - green
Regular price
£19.40
Regular price
Sale price
£19.40
Unit price
per
Shipping calculated at checkout.
Couldn't load pickup availability
